A Pub in a Hole

A 'Tardisss' pub that comes with a rattle
Location: 5 Mepham Street, SE1 8SQ
Description: Now I like this pub...why...well because it's just a proper boozer with 'what you see is what you get' - there's no pretense here. But there's a bit more...
From the roadside it looks like a small pub under the railway, but on further investigation, it becomes a much bigger pub with a larger bar behind the front bar.
With the added surpise of Waterloo Station trains rattling overhead, which actually causes the place to vibrate, there are good beers, fines wines, essetial nibbles, and attentive bar staff.
So when you are next at Waterloo, don't go to the pub in the station, walk the short distance and go here!
